Score! Gola Collaborates with Christian Lacroix

Brit sports brand Gola has teamed up with esteemed designer Christian Lacroix for a collection of men’s and women’s footwear that creatively merges high fashion with sport. The four styles, which will become available for the Spring/Summer 2009 season are composed of luxe leathers, vibrant colors, with intricate embroidery and embossing.

Free YSL Totes — September 6th — New York City


We recently learned via WWD that Yves Saint Laurent will be distributing free logo totes with a catalog inside on September 6th. The location is yet to be released, while the uber-chic black and white totes are purposely adorned with an upside down YSL logo. Stay tuned for more info!

UPDATE: Fashion Pulse discovered that the bags were handed out rather rapidly, around 2pm by the tents at Bryant Park, and distributing white totes at Soho House (Hotel) In the Meatpacking District. We even saw one guy at the tents in a white, upside down YSL shirt! If you missed out, we found a few of them on ebay , and as of Sunday, September 7th, the prices were only $8 — let’s see what happens…

Beauty Beat: Neon Eyeshadows

I stopped dead in my tracks, while walking through the neighborhood Duane Reade, when I spotted  the latest Cover Girl 4-kit eyeshadows. Luscious shades of yellow, orange, shimmery turquoise, inky black, lavender, and cobalt danced before our eyes, and for about $6 for four shades, we don’t mind experimenting with some funky eye colors!
